Output 6688eb3d95a47a7d5d1d29d00deca97881391360c457d3909af4caecdc0864b1:7

value
7285068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ded56411444f059820c340e980cb8095fde8ae21 OP_EQUAL
address
3N1FZniLXp47qsvQz2XjBKK1wDsqEZwMr5
transaction
6688eb3d95a47a7d5d1d29d00deca97881391360c457d3909af4caecdc0864b1
confirmations
164125
spent
true